Subject: Quickstore 4.2 — bloom filter now fronts the KV layer

Plugin authors: starting with this release, Quickstore places a bloom filter ahead of the key-value store. Negative lookups return faster; false positives fall through safely. No API changes are required on your side. Verify your plugin against the staging build referenced below.

session token of fahif-tadup = htk3_9c7

[ ] Key ceremony step 7 — Routewise driver-assignment heuristic

Confirm the sealed build of the Routewise heuristic matches the signed manifest before keys are cut. Heuristic weights (proximity, shift balance, fatigue score) are frozen for this release; no hotfixes post-ceremony. Two witnesses required. Release manager signs the attestation sheet, then seals the HSM envelope. Abort if checksums diverge — do not proceed on verbal assurance. Once the envelope is sealed, unlock the ceremony ledger with the recovery passphrase below.

vault phrase of kafog-kahif = holdor-rusir-praox

Hey Priya, quick handover before I'm out. The Kioskline watchdog restarts the shell app if the heartbeat stalls for 30s, but note it runs as root on older units — that's the bit security will care about. We've got a ticket to drop privileges, half done on the restart-policy branch. Logs rotate daily, nothing persists beyond a week. Full details, threat notes, and the privilege matrix are on the internal wiki page here.

wiki page, tahaf-tajog: https://jira.ordindyn.corp/pipeline